Have your ... WebNov 24, 2024 · Introduction. Postcoital bleeding is defined as nonmenstrual bleeding or spotting occurring immediately after sexual intercourse. Estimates of the prevalence of postcoital bleeding in the community range from 0.7 to 9.0%, with an annual cumulative incidence of 6% in premenopausal women. 1 Although postcoital bleeding is considered …

WebJan 25, 2024 · Dyspareunia is a term used for pain felt in the genital area or pelvis during (or after having) vaginal sex. Nobody really knows exactly how common it is, as many women never seek medical help. However, questionnaires asking women if they have symptoms suggest that somewhere between 1 and 4 out of 10 women experience it. WebLochia is vaginal discharge after childbirth.
